Request for Quotation

  • Popularity Score 4413 Popularity Score

    Popularity ScoreReferrals to Site/Downloads

    0 0 1+ 1+ 250+ 250+ 1000+ 1000+ 10000+ 10000+

  • Magento Connect Silver Industry Partner
Complete Request for Quote (RFQ) solution. Manage and create quote requests via the front-end or backend.
Compatible with:
This extension is currently unavailable on Magento Connect. Please contact the developer.

You will be re-directed to the developer's website to complete your purchase.

You must be registered and logged in to get extension key.
In order to get this extension, you must be logged in to the Magento Community. Click here to login or register.

Magento Connect


Request for Quotation

The trusted quotation module for 6k+ users
Find out why Cart2Quote is the most popular B2B extension and get started for FREE.

"Cart2Quote has become an exceptionally convenient
time-saver and a massive money-saver. Cart2Quote
doesn’t just process quote requests it has turned our business around."

              Ryan Freeman, President National Fitness Distributors



Strategically Place Quotation Buttons

• Enable “add to quote” buttons per specific product
• Enable “add to quote” buttons per store view or website
• Enable quotations and quote buttons for specific customer groups
• Specify the visibility of buttons in the Magento grid/list view
• Configure the visibility of the "add to quote" buttons on the product page
• Cart2Quote supports all Magento product types (checkout the demo store)



Create Proposals Via Your Magento Backend

• Enter custom prices per product
• Add custom shipping prices
• Add additional surcharges per quote with Fooman Surcharge (when installed)
• Upload additional attachments with a proposal email
• Enter shop owner comments per product
• Show realtime profit/reduction margins
• Add or delete products from the quote request
• Add or delete tier quantities for a specific product
• Convert a quote request to order using the admin panel
• Configure the visibility of the "add to quote" buttons on the product page
• Auto-send proposals based on Magento tier prices



Customer Relationship Management (CRM)

• Send PDF proposals by email
• Send reminders and expiry emails (transactional emails)
• Manually send messages from within Magento (CRM)
• Create and update custom message templates



Assign specific sales representatives

• Assign sales people to quotation requests manually or automatically
• Add internal comments to a quote request
• Assign super admins with special rights
• Show all quotation requests per customer in a grid



Connect with your favorite CRM & ERP systems

• API with wsdl2 support (download the API manual)
• Quote request export via the Quotation grid actions
• Out of the box SalesForce integration with our partner PowerSync



Customize your Cart and Checkout + Not2Order

• Set alternative checkout URL for third party checkouts
• Disable order references in the cart
• Enable Ajax add to quote popup

"Unlike other quotation solutions out there, Cart2Quote is developed to create more sales. It is not simply adding a quotation button and form, but it is adding a completely new sales channel to your Magento store!"

What our customers say:

"Cart2Quote is the extension of choice.... These guys deliver great tools! With the lack of quoting extensions out there it is surprising to find their extensions so well done! True quoting with great functionality without much competition shows how great of a company they are... Well done guys... Well done…"

              TurboDoug on Magento Connect

"Why -Reinventing the wheel- as it's already (well) done, We integrated it in a global solution as we need to provide this functions to our customers. we start from the free version, went to the Professional and soon we'll go on the Entreprises for it's ability to communicate via the API."

              Galilee on Magento Connect

"Cart2Quote has dramatically enhanced the experience that we are able to offer our customers. We are a fast paced business that has succeeded by being flexible for our customers, and Cart2Quote allows us to bring some of that flexibility in to the static environment of the online store. Not only is Cart2Quote great software, but the team behind it is professional and responsive. We recently also purchased Not2Order, another great app, and can't wait to see what they do next."

              Sam Crowther on Magento Connect

More testimonials and examples



Versions & Pricing

We offer five versions of our Magento Quotation Module:
Free, Starter, Business, Enterprise and Corporate.
- The Free version offers only the front-end side of the quote request
- The Starter and Business versions are fully loaded
- The Business and Enterprise versions are usable on unlimited domains
- The Corporate version has unlimited development licenses

Compare The Cart2Quote Versions.

Looking to hide prices and disable the ordering of products in combination with Cart2Quote? Have a look at Not2order also.
This Magento extension works seamlessly with Cart2Quote.
Go to: Not2order - Hide Prices, Disable Ordering


Web: Cart2Quote website
Screenshots: Quotation processes and screenshots
Showcases: Examples and Testimonials
Live Demonstration: Live demo Magento quotations
Pricing: Versions and Prices Cart2Quote
Support: Support forum

Cart2Quote Versions

Now you're in Business
5 stars

M1 Extension Versions

Release Notes - Cart2Quote 5.2.4-stable (February 08, 2016)

2016-02-09 12:19:29
  • Version number: 5.2.4
  • Stability: Stable
  • Compatibility: 1.7, 1.8, 1.8.1, 1.9, 1.9.1, 1.9.2, 1.12, 1.13, 1.13.1, 1.14, 1.14.1, 1.14.2
Magento version requirements

Magento 1.7+
PHP 5.3+


Fixed: Base design always asumes a filled shipping address
Fixed: Cost price always set to 0,00

Release Notes - Cart2Quote 5.2.3-stable (February 03, 2016)

2016-02-08 16:34:10
  • Version number: 5.2.3
  • Stability: Stable
  • Compatibility: 1.7, 1.8, 1.8.1, 1.9, 1.9.1, 1.9.2, 1.13, 1.13.1, 1.14, 1.14.1, 1.14.2
Magento version requirements

Magento 1.7+
PHP 5.3+


Added: "Clear Quote" button to my quotes page
Added: Create, accept and reject quote through SOAP API
Added: Optional support for MageWorx_DeliveryZone
Added: Option to save space by changing the font in the PDF to Times New Roman
Added: Support for Ayasoftware_SimpleProductPricing
Added: Taiwanese translation


Fixed: Address details not visible on quotes in backend
Fixed: Company field was missing in old themes
Fixed: Customer group id is not set on quotes created in the frontend
Fixed: Email not saved on quote request when using a legacy template
Fixed: Error on line 42 in Apo.php
Fixed: Error when email checking is disabled and a quote is requested with an existing account
Fixed: Error in Fakepro/Helper/Data.php on line 453
Fixed: File option on products are not added when using ajax add to quote
Fixed: Js error on product pages when quick quote is not used
Fixed: Miniquote is different from Minicart
Fixed: Notice in indexController.php
Fixed: ReferenceError: newEmptyCell is not defined
Fixed: Registration mode setting wasn't functioning right
Fixed: Related product overwrites qty of parent product.
Fixed: Tax calculation issue introduced in v5.2.2 for catalogs that have products including tax


Improved: Chinese translations
Improved: Edit option for the Cost Price is visible in the backend now
Improved: Finnish translation
Improved: PDF rendering for fake products
Improved: Shipping calculation is now compatible with the weight option of APO
Improved: SUPEE-7405

Release Notes - Cart2Quote 5.2.2-stable (January 6, 2016)

2016-01-06 16:40:24
  • Version number: 5.2.2.
  • Stability: Stable
  • Compatibility: 1.7, 1.8, 1.8.1, 1.9, 1.9.1, 1.9.2, 1.12, 1.13, 1.13.1, 1.14, 1.14.1, 1.14.2
Magento version requirements

Magento 1.7+
PHP 5.3+


Added: Fake Products
Added: General quote remarks can be disabled now
Added: Notice of changed/new quotes on login in backend
Added: Product remarks can be disabled now
Added: Quotes can show multiple linked childs now on the backend quote edit page
Added: Shopping Cart Rules compatibility (BETA)
Added: Support for PHP 7


Fixed: Blank page when no product can be added in the frontend
Fixed: Can't rename temporary table in the CRM setup script
Fixed: Customer object wasn't available for the total collectors
Fixed: Customer TAX class wasn't used
Fixed: 'Default base' vs 'base store' of 'store view' TAX settings
Fixed: Discount calculation uses default TAX class instead of billing address TAX class
Fixed: Downloadable product couldn't use custom prices
Fixed: Email logging didn't log default Magento email sender
Fixed: Email shows no item price on some configurations
Fixed: Error message "impossible to create a column without comment" for column customer_notified
Fixed: Error on line 42 in Apo.php
Fixed: Error on the 'Quote Configuration' page when custom shipping methods are installed
Fixed: Get customer group id is always loaded from the customer instead of the quote object
Fixed: GetWeight on the address returns the address itself instead of the weight
Fixed: In some cases base TAX rate of the default store was used instead of website
Fixed: Issue with Image rendering from url's in the PDF
Fixed: Issue with PNG rendering in the PDF
Fixed: Mage_Customer_Model_Customer given where Mage_Customer_Model_Address is expected constraint error in checkDefaultAddress
Fixed: Mod_security gets triggered on quote save in the backend
Fixed: New subtotal calculation uses original price instead of overwritten price to calculate the price difference
Fixed: Out of stock product cant be removed from quote in the backend
Fixed: Permission issue in Cart2Quote backend when an user doesn't has the CRM Addon permission
Fixed: Quick request via quick-quote submits order form
Fixed: Quote adjustment on PDF wrong on multi-currency setups
Fixed: Quote adjustment needs another save when calculation on page load is disabled
Fixed: Quote needs another save when shipping or subtotal is changed
Fixed: Quotes with the status STATUS_PROPOSAL_ACTION_OWNER and STATUS_PROPOSAL_ACTION_CUSTOMER can't be accepted
Fixed: Region is not saved when it isn't a registered region id
Fixed: Removing the key on quoteadv_crmaddon_messages results in an error in the setup script
Fixed: Request email is not sent to customer
Fixed: Saving that quote lowers the expiry date by one day on some configurations
Fixed: Selected shipping method in the frontend isn't used
Fixed: Shipping cost persistence when speed improvements are enabled
Fixed: Shipping type has only one char in the database while it can be ten chars
Fixed: Short description on PDF now starts after the image
Fixed: Some older customization where not compatible with some new code regarding the emails and the HTML PDF's


Improved: Added a check for mod_security on the support page
Improved: Added a check on the support page that warns if the Cart2Quote shipping method is disabled
Improved: Added Chinese language files
Improved: Added Finnish translation files
Improved: Cart2Quote shipping method is default set to active
Improved: Compatibility with old template files, from before v5.2.1
Improved: Customer group is now persistent on quote to order actions
Improved: New manuals
Improved: PDF rendering is more dynamic (address, totals, remarks and logo)
Improved: Quote increments now get a new creation date
Improved: Renamed 'Qquote Shipping Proposal Name - Qquote Shipping Proposal Method' to 'Custom Shipping Price - Quote'
Improved: Supplier Bidding Tool information page
Improved: When catalog prices are set including tax, Cart2Quote totals collector removes the tax from the products
Improved: When catalog prices are set including tax, the total block on the edit quote page has the correct tax settings now

Release Notes - Cart2Quote 5.2.1-stable (December 7, 2015)

2015-12-09 14:00:35
  • Version number: 5.2.1.
  • Stability: Stable
  • Compatibility: 1.7, 1.8, 1.8.1, 1.9, 1.9.1, 1.9.2, 1.12, 1.13, 1.13.1, 1.14, 1.14.1, 1.14.2
Magento version requirements

Magento 1.7+
PHP 5.3+


Added: Disable/enable remarks on quote form in the frontend
Added: Form Builder 'Require Billing-/Shipping Address on Quote' setting per Customer Group
Added: Logged in customers can now select saved addresses
Added: Minicart for RWD theme (minicart implementation example for custom themes)


Fixed: Email header used default logo instead of store logo for cron emails (reminder, expiry)
Fixed: Email logging has a fatal error when `Ebizmarts_Mandrill` is enabled
Fixed: Error in wsdl.xml (issue with Visual Studio connection)
Fixed: Extended license keys not working
Fixed: Id missing on quote request on certain configurations
Fixed: SendExpiryEmail and sendReminderEmail didn't trigger on quotes with a sales rep status
Fixed: The expiry date doesn't use store config when quote is created in backend
Fixed: Typo in update/installer scripts


Improved: Added support for Ebizmarts_Mandrill (in Cart2Quote)
Improved: Better notice when product is not saleable
Improved: Check compatibility helper for newer versions of APO (Mageworx renamed helper)
Improved: CRMAddon SQL small improvement
Improved: Default calculate_quote_totals_on_load set to 1 as this feature seems a bit unstable
Improved: Default shipping and billing address is not being overwritten per quote request
Improved: Error when using invalid template files
Improved: Email images have more fallbacks if there is not an image available
Improved: Grouped product will now redirect to grouped product instead of simple in quote basket
Improved: Module is disabled message says now which module is disabled
Improved: PDF address box is now dynamic in size
Improved: PDF font size increased with 1 pixel
Improved: PDF image rendering optimization (advanced settings)
Improved: PDF image size increased (from 30 to 60)
Improved: PDF now mentions QUOTATION at the top of the page
Improved: PDF now shows the selected shipping option (and hides the other options)
Improved: Quote grid in adminhtml now sorts on create date instead of quoteid
Improved: Quote view improved responsiveness for RWD theme
Improved: SQL update checks
Improved: Supplier bidding tool page
Improved: When auto proposal is enabled, the store-owner can add a default shipping method for the quote


This release can break your theme integration when you have "template/qquoteadv/quote_address.phtml" customized

Release Notes - Cart2Quote 5.2.0-stable (October 28, 2015)

2015-10-29 09:34:04
  • Version number: 5.2.0.
  • Stability: Stable
  • Compatibility: 1.7, 1.8, 1.8.1, 1.9, 1.9.1, 1.9.2, 1.12, 1.13, 1.13.1, 1.14, 1.14.1, 1.14.2
Magento version requirements

Magento 1.7+
PHP 5.3+


Added: Email notifications
Added: Sales representative assign overwrite per customer
Added: Preparation for Supplier Bidding tool learn more


Fixed: Accepted/Expiry/Reminder email now uses multiple store transactional emails.
Fixed: Base design doesn't show shipping address form on quote request when customer is logged in.
Fixed: CSV export with multiple of the same configurables has wrong qty
Fixed: Edit-increment always -1
Fixed: Email logging doesn't work when a SMTP module is installed
Fixed: Email templates uses wrong theme
Fixed: Error 152 on sql update
Fixed: Exporting to CSV add a line break after the address on some configuration
Fixed: Fatal error on mass status update
Fixed: Frontend currency switcher doesn't affect the backend currency
Fixed: Multi-currency support for setups where the base currency is different from the default base currency
Fixed: Multiple configurables with the same id can have wrong SKUs on the edit quote page
Fixed: Possible warning on System>Configuration page
Fixed: SQL error in update script v5.0.5 - v5.0.6
Fixed: The notify customer option in the CRMAddon doesn't work on some configurations
Fixed: Warning undefined index "cost_price" in admin panel ( not always set )
Fixed: When minimum order amount is enabled, you receive an error on checkout.


Improved: Added warning when Multi-currency rates are not complete
Improved: Bundle original price is now calculated on request not on every refresh. (speed improvement)
Improved: CRMAddon now shows success message in the backend
Improved: Customer select (dropdown) in grid shows now only customers with a quote
Improved: Date formats in adminhtml (Get dateformat in adminhtml from locale xml)
Improved: Edit quote page in backend doesn't has to calculate the totals. (800% speed improvement)
Improved: Email templates are now rendered once. (15% speed improvement on submit proposal)
Improved: Error logging for the CRMAddon
Improved: Fallback when getProductByAttributes returns null
Improved: Layout (backend) is now being set using the layout files
Improved: Lowered the count of collect totals. (15% speed improvement on save actions in the backend)
Improved: Lowered the count of Quote object reloads in the backend. (10% speed improvement overall)
Improved: New close-btn resize from 14Kb to 200b
Improved: PDF generation loads less objects. (speed improvement)
Improved: Removed unnecessary Qquoteadv rewrite in CRMaddon
Improved: Renamed 'trail note' to 'system message'
Improved: Support for unknown email modules
Improved: Support page shows more info
Improved: TAX/VAT conversion notice is only shown when rates are different


Tested: SUPEE-6788
Improved: 'System>Configuration>Cart2Quote>Advanced Settings>Backend>Calculate Totals on Page Load' default set to 'No'
1 2 3

About the Developer

This extension was developed by and is supported by Cart2Quote

Get Help

Support for This Extension

The best place to start if you need help with a specific extension is to contact the developer. All Magento developers have both a contact email and a support email listed.

Magento Platform Support

If you need support for a Magento platform, there are different options for support depending on which Magento platform you are using. Below are links for specific platforms.

In order to upload extension, you must be logged in to the Magento Community. Click here to login or register.



* Required Fields

Close window

Forgot Your Password?

Please enter your email below and we'll send you a new password.

* Required Fields

Close window


To upload extension you must be logged in.

* Required Fields

Close window

You are using an outdated browser

We built Magento Connect using the latest techniques and technologies.
This makes Magento Connect faster and easier to use.
Unfortunately, your browser doesn't support those technologies.
Use the links below to download a new browser or upgrade your existing browser.